DVD Menus
I am very interested in recreating DVD menus for my Divx rips. I have recently developed a technique in which I can emulate the menu through html, and I am currently looking into reproducing menus with Flash. However, this is a rather tedious process to manually reproduce the menus. For example, I have to make all of the different connections like "when you click here, it takes you here". I am wondering if there is any software out there that can read this sort of information out of a DVD? Like PowerDVD knows where you can click and where to take you and all. If this information can be extracted, it may be possible for me to automate the process of recreating the menus somewhat. So does anyone know how I could access that information off my DVDs?
